For Springs unser community to grow significantly, I believe we need the following, in order of importance:smoth wrote:After that MAJOR bug is dealt with I AM confident that spring's community will explode.
() No desyncs
() Some kind of ranking system built into the lobby that depends on wins/losses/disconnects
() Mods that stay consistent over months to years
() A nice, useable GUI out of the box
() A way to easily play single-player skirmishes out of the box
() A way to automatically download maps and mods from the lobby
() Map scripting for fun minigames like tower defense and stuff.
